安装SQL Server2014 :规则”Windows Management Instrumentation (WMI)服务 “失败
? ? ? 裝上win10后,需要用到SQL Server ,我就按照平常一樣去裝SQL 2008,不過(guò)遺憾的是,貌似不兼容。網(wǎng)上查了一下說(shuō)SQL2014好像可以,我就下載一個(gè)SQL2014去裝,不過(guò)還是老出現(xiàn)問(wèn)題,就是下圖的問(wèn)題:
?
?
?
? ? ? ? 中間花了不少時(shí)間去試著解決這個(gè)問(wèn)題,大概有三次,都沒(méi)有成功。還好專業(yè)課要用,讓我沒(méi)有就這樣放棄尋找解決方法。最后,Thanks god .讓我在一個(gè)網(wǎng)頁(yè)的最底下找到了原因和解決方法,完美解決了無(wú)法啟動(dòng)WMI服務(wù)的問(wèn)題。
?
原因:Windows Management Instrumentation(WMI)服務(wù)遭到損壞。
?
解決方法:重建損壞的Windows Management Instrumentation(WMI)服務(wù)。將這段代碼復(fù)制到txt文檔中,然后將txt文檔改成.bat格式,再右擊這個(gè).bat格式的文件,以管理員身份運(yùn)行,等待運(yùn)行完成(代碼靜止),再次安裝SQL就沒(méi)問(wèn)題了。
?
@echo on cd /d c:\temp if not exist %windir%\system32\wbem goto TryInstall cd /d %windir%\system32\wbem net stop winmgmt winmgmt /kill if exist Rep_bak rd Rep_bak /s /q rename Repository Rep_bak for %%i in (*.dll) do RegSvr32 -s %%i for %%i in (*.exe) do call :FixSrv %%i for %%i in (*.mof,*.mfl) do Mofcomp %%i net start winmgmt goto End :FixSrv if /I (%1) == (wbemcntl.exe) goto SkipSrv if /I (%1) == (wbemtest.exe) goto SkipSrv if /I (%1) == (mofcomp.exe) goto SkipSrv %1 /RegServer :SkipSrv goto End :TryInstall if not exist wmicore.exe goto End wmicore /s net start winmgmt :End?
?曬一下我裝完成后的效果:
?
?
? ? ? 總結(jié):結(jié)合之前的經(jīng)驗(yàn),我得出兩條想法:一、永遠(yuǎn)不要提前退出,無(wú)論是在團(tuán)隊(duì)中還是游戲里,亦或是找問(wèn)題時(shí)。二、只要有問(wèn)題就一定可以解決。
?
?
?
?
總結(jié)
以上是生活随笔為你收集整理的安装SQL Server2014 :规则”Windows Management Instrumentation (WMI)服务 “失败的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 5G、AI、云计算走进抗疫最前线,请为这
- 下一篇: java信息管理系统总结_java实现科